你查询的IP:[118.242.33.71]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询119.223.98.247 58.100.153.20 218.73.66.16 118.80.165.163 118.212.152.251 123.177.205.36 119.254.105.242 202.130.141.86 203.148.150.23 118.242.33.71 203.100.80.92 202.38.138.242 61.232.144.53 202.165.96.96 61.4.176.114 58.144.230.226 211.136.172.161 123.4.178.254 218.64.21.212 117.128.20.69 61.28.84.245 202.3.176.141 203.86.64.70 202.95.104.157 123.177.154.227 221.199.224.117 202.38.192.188 116.204.187.157 116.70.136.173 202.131.208.64 123.99.128.11